Unlike mainstream RTS games like Company of Heroes , Gates of Hell operates on a "simulation-first" basis. This specific version represents a stage in the game's evolution where the developers (Barbed Wire Studios) moved closer to the "Men of War" legacy while stripping away the arcade-like elements.

The "Ostfront" setting isn't just a skin; it dictates the pacing. The maps are often vast, reflecting the sweeping plains of Russia and Ukraine.
